Senator Murray Sinclair, as the Commissioner of the Truth and Reconciliation Commission of Canada, heard thousands of accounts from Indian Residential School survivors.  The discovery of child remains at Indian Residential Schools across Canada has brought into  Canadian consciousness the historical atrocities that have impacted Indigenous peoples for generations.

This three day training is an introduction to the neurobiology of trauma grounded in Indigenous approaches to healing and spiritual balance and includes:

  • An overview of the neurobiology of trauma in relation to Indigenous history
  • Psychosocial conditioning as it applies to conditioning and possibility
  • Cultural teachings, language and principles that support transformational change
  • Spiritual practices that support transformational change
  • Practical exercises for self-regulations
  • Resources to support ongoing learning
